AwanTunai is the leading vertical fintech player digitizing the offline FMCG supply chain in Indonesia. We solve for both operational and financing pain points through ERP software and integrated embedded financing for offline suppliers. Our traditional suppliers have aggregate annual sales of over $3bn+ and our embedded financing is on track to reach the annualized $1bn milestone next quarter. We have been growing revenues at an average 30% QoQ with 0.2% credit loss rates over the pandemic period across hundreds of traditional suppliers.
Our financial impact has won accolades from the UNCDF, Monetary Authority of Singapore, and with the IFC (World Bank Group) as a major shareholder. Management and our impact focused shareholders are committed to building a world class team regardless of diversity or location.
Its vision is to help millions of micro SMEs flourish through affordable working capital and digitization. Our goal is to modernize the traditional domestic demand trade in Indonesia. We have created an order management system and digital payment acceptance for the traditional offline FMCG and staple food supply chain.
AwanTunai was founded by Silicon Valley veterans who have returned to Indonesia, with an experienced management and technical team from renowned companies such as GoJek, Redmart, McKinsey, and Morgan Stanley. Our team is over 100 strong, with an active user base of over 20,000 and over 1,000 participating retail merchants.
